Minsala Marine is a conventional oil development located in shallow water in Congo Republic and is operated by Eni Congo. Discovered in 2014, Minsala Marine lies in block Marine XII and Minsala, with water depth of around 246 feet.

The project is currently in feasibility stage and is expected to start commercial production in 2026. Final investment decision (FID) of the project will be approved in 2024. The Minsala Marine conventional oil development will involve the drilling of approximately one wells.

Field participation details

The field is owned by Lukoil Oil, Societe Nationale des Petroles du Congo and Eni.


Production from Minsala Marine

Production from the Minsala Marine conventional oil development project is expected to begin in 2026 and is forecast to peak in 2028, to approximately 31,310 bpd of crude oil and condensate and 184 Mmcfd of natural gas. Based on economic assumptions, the production will continue until the field reaches its economic limit in 2041.


Remaining recoverable reserves

The field is expected to recover 122.13 Mmboe, comprised of 61.75 Mmbbl of crude oil & condensate and 362.24 bcf of natural gas reserves.
